Transaction 5a10d2c17d0303af25cb6932ab9a361aed409e325124c90a6942cc8435dfafb1

1 Input
2 Outputs
  • 5a10d2c17d0303af25cb6932ab9a361aed409e325124c90a6942cc8435dfafb1:0
  • value  657300
    address  1DBfZUpFjotrxcwE67bZUVjEDqB95pxXKV
  • 5a10d2c17d0303af25cb6932ab9a361aed409e325124c90a6942cc8435dfafb1:1
  • value  21349883
    address  3FubLRZdptTvgHWLN7cR9ktodz4qxhcgik